1. Cardiovascular Medications
Beta-blockers and ACE inhibitors used for high blood pressure or heart failure are frequently titrated. If a client starts on a complete dosage instantly, their blood pressure may drop too quickly, triggering fainting or "orthostatic hypotension."
2. Mental Health Medications
Antidepressants (SSRIs/SNRIs) and antipsychotics are traditional examples of up-titrated drugs. The brain needs time to adjust to changes in neurotransmitter levels. Progressive increases help lessen initial adverse effects like queasiness or heightened anxiety.
3. Neurological and Pain Management
Medications for epilepsy (anticonvulsants) or persistent nerve discomfort (gabapentinoids) are titrated to prevent severe drowsiness or cognitive "fog." Likewise, opioid treatment-- when needed-- needs stringent titration to manage discomfort while reducing the danger of respiratory anxiety.
4. Endocrine Disorders
Insulin titration is an everyday truth for many individuals with diabetes. Based upon blood glucose readings, the dosage is adapted to match carbohydrate consumption and exercise.

Regularly Asked Questions (FAQ)1. Why can't my medical professional just provide me the complete dosage right now?
Beginning with a complete dose can overwhelm your body's systems. For many drugs, the body requires time to develop up tolerance to side results. "Jumping" to a high dosage can result in serious negative responses or toxicity.
2. For how long does a normal titration procedure take?
The duration depends totally on the medication and the condition. Some titrations take place over a few days (like specific pain medications), while others, like antidepressants or thyroid medications, can take several months to settle.
3. What should I do if I miss out on a dosage during the titration duration?
Consistency is essential throughout titration. If a dose is missed out on, clients ought to consult their pharmacist or physician instantly. Generally, you need to not double the dose to "capture up," as this might hinder the titration information.
4. Can I titrate my own medication if I feel it's not working?
No. Titration must always be carried out under the guidance of a licensed medical expert. Adjusting your own dosage can result in unsafe side impacts, withdrawal symptoms, or "rebound" impacts where the original condition returns more severely.
5. Does a greater dose constantly imply the medication is more reliable?
Not necessarily. In medicine, there is an idea called the "ceiling effect," where increasing a dose beyond a particular point supplies no extra benefit but substantially increases the danger of toxicity. The objective of titration is to discover the most affordable reliable dose, not the greatest.
